Mets counting on connections to land free agent
Delgado

Jan. 13, 2005
SportsLine.com wire reports

SAN JUAN, Puerto Rico -- Mets executives met with
Carlos Delgado on Thursday, hoping the tactic that
helped land Carlos Beltran and Pedro Martinez would
lure the free-agent first baseman to New York.

Already in Puerto Rico with Beltran, general manager
Omar Minaya and three others met with the 32-year-old
slugger in a San Juan hotel, Mets spokesman Jay
Horwitz said.

"It was just kind of a meet-and-greet thing,"
Delgado's agent, David Sloane, said. "It was all
non-contractual, just a chance for those guys to get
to meet each other. The meeting was over in about 20,
30 minutes."

In his first visit to his native Puerto Rico since
signing a seven-year, $119 million contract with the
Mets on Tuesday, Beltran said the presence of two
Latinos in New York's front office -- Minaya, who is
Dominican, and his special assistant Tony Bernazard, a
Puerto Rican -- gave the Mets a family appeal that
made him lean toward the team.
